The SOM is responsible for managing daily shift responsibilities of the paper mill, including shipping and stock preparation, safety and quality operations, managing production costs, monitoring environmental waste control, and employee relations. The SOM also has mill-wide responsibilities for prioritizing shift maintenance and responding to emergencies.
MAJOR JOB RESPONSIBILITIES:
Business Excellence
Ensure daily production and maintenance targets and delivery schedules are met in compliance with manufacturing deadlines by allocating personnel, setting up the equipment, re-working parts and personally supporting the troubleshooting efforts.Maintain quality and environmental parameters within prescribed limits, basing decisions on operating conditions and trends.Ensure quality specifications are met; understand key drivers and troubleshoot to meet quality specifications if problems exist.Lead pre-shift safety meetings and monthly safety training meetings to prevent injuries, eliminate hazards, improve housekeeping, and comply with all applicable regulations and mill policies.Communicate requirements with stakeholders in logistics, purchasing, quality, and assembly to ensure necessary information exchange.Coordinate maintenance work to maintain productivity levels and manufacturing needs.Monitor processes to meet the quality goals to ensure customer satisfaction.Maintain staff planning and alter schedules to adapt to unforeseen conditions and maximize productivity.People and Culture
Ensure reliable employee performance and compliance with environmental, safety, production, and quality requirements.Resolve customer issues and identify preventative solutions.Supervise assigned shift employees to accomplish daily safety, quality, productivity and efficiency goals.Oversee workforce planning through assigning and directing work, conducting employee performance reviews and coaching employees to achieve developmental goals.
